Default ac not working right

I have a 90 gt that the ac will stop working on sometimes. When it stops working it is after I have been driving around for awhile the compressor kicks off when this happens. Then it may work again with out even killing the car just turning of the ac for awhile, and it's always worked if I kill the car and let sit for 20 mins or so. Other days I may have no trouble at all. The compressor sounds good when it's running. What should be some of the things I need to check for.

If you have an electric fan make sure it's wired to the A/C circuit, and check to see if the condenser is plugged. Other than that put some gauges on it to see what's happening.
